Output 851ed3974ed643254bd65232327e4415f7dfe36d674da25d97c78359104836e2:0

value
1040454
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a77c70c75aec627e56e66a38794712695576d5ca OP_EQUAL
address
3GxbqrpqoguekLhXJSMiTsfRn8TEuXKAzc
transaction
851ed3974ed643254bd65232327e4415f7dfe36d674da25d97c78359104836e2
spent
true